Braised veal loin is a lean, tender cut of young beef, slow-cooked in liquid until it becomes fork-tender with a delicate, mild flavor. Its texture is fine-grained and succulent, offering a refined alternative to more robust beef cuts. Nutritionally, it's a powerhouse of high-quality protein with minimal fat, making it an excellent choice for a protein-focused meal.

⚠️ Watch-outs & how to enjoy it better

As a red meat, it should be consumed in moderation by those monitoring saturated fat intake or with specific heart-health concerns. The braising process often involves added salt or wine, which can increase sodium content. Tip: Use low-sodium broth and control added salt; pair with potassium-rich vegetables like spinach or tomatoes to help balance sodium levels.

FAQ

How does braised veal loin differ from braised beef chuck?
Veal loin is significantly leaner and more tender, with a milder, sweeter flavor. Beef chuck has more connective tissue and fat, resulting in a richer, beefier taste and a slightly chewier texture after braising.

Is braised veal loin a good option for a low-fat diet?
Yes, the lean-only cut is very low in fat (9.15g per 100g), especially compared to many other braising cuts. Choosing this cut and trimming any visible fat makes it suitable for a low-fat diet.

What is the best liquid to braise veal loin in?
A combination of dry white wine (like Pinot Grigio) and a light chicken or vegetable stock is classic, as it complements the veal's delicate flavor without overpowering it. Tomato-based braises are also common in dishes like Osso Buco.
